United States, October 2025 – Katy Hendricks has been elevated to the role of Chief Marketing Officer at Powell Communications, marking a significant milestone in her career with the firm. In this new capacity, she will oversee the agency’s marketing strategy, client engagement, and growth initiatives, reinforcing Powell’s position as a leading force in public relations and communications.
Hendricks has been with Powell Communications for nearly five years, most recently serving as Executive Vice President of Business Strategy and Growth. In this role, she spearheaded client acquisition, expanded corporate partnerships, and led strategic initiatives to strengthen the agency’s growth trajectory across industries.
Prior to this, she served as Vice President at G&S Business Communications, where she focused on growth and corporate communications, enhancing the agency’s presence in the Greater Tampa Bay Area. Earlier, she worked with CooperKatz & Company, where across more than a decade she rose to become Director of Client Services, managing high-profile accounts and leading integrated communication strategies.
Her earlier roles at G&S included leadership positions in client engagement, growth initiatives, and corporate communications, further sharpening her expertise in brand building and business development.
Katy Hendricks earned her Bachelor of Science in Public Relations from the University of Florida, equipping her with a strong academic foundation in strategic communications.
